Subject: Quickstore 4.2 — bloom filter now fronts the KV layer

Plugin authors: starting with this release, Quickstore places a bloom filter ahead of the key-value store. Negative lookups return faster; false positives fall through safely. No API changes are required on your side. Verify your plugin against the staging build referenced below.

session token of fahif-tadup = htk3_9c7

Handover note — TallyGate, Orrin to Mabel

New folks: TallyGate counts turnstile entries at Dunmore Park. Cron reconciles totals at 02:00; check the drift report each morning. The admin console occasionally drops sessions after firmware pushes — just log back in. If the console refuses all logins after a push, use the recovery passphrase recorded directly beneath this note.

unlock words, hahip-baduf: holwyn-istath-julvan

== Quarterly Stock-Count Ledger: Transport Notes ==

Heads up for folks at the Castelmar receiving site: the quarterly stock-count ledger comes over from the Dunreath warehouse in a sealed red folio pouch, usually mid-morning on count day. Don't let it sit on the dock — it goes straight to the records room and gets signed in. If the pouch seal looks tampered with, refuse it. One more thing before the courier arrives: the confidential hand-over instruction is listed right below.

courier memo of tawep-tajep: the quenius ulaiel courier leaves the fenir ledger at gate 9128 under passcode 527513